Three weeks ago we had a very large number of site errors revealed by crawl diagostics. These errors related purely to the presence of both http://domain name and http://www.domain name. We used the rel canonical tag in the head of our index page to direct all to the www. preference, and we have no improvement. Matters got worse two weeks ago and I checked with Google Webmaster and found that Google had somehow lost our preference choice. A week ago I asked how to overcome this problem and received good advice about how to re-enter our preference for the www.tag with Google. This we did and it was accepted. We aso submitted a new sitemap.xml which was also acceptable to Google. Today, a week later we find that we have even more duplicate content (over 10,000 duplicate errors) showing up in the latest diagnostic crawl. Does anyone have any ideas? (Getting a bit desperate.)

Okay so not bad. You just need to deal with www and non www urls.
If you have access to your htaccess file you can do it very easily with
RewriteEngine On RewriteBase / R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} !^www.
fly-fishing-tackle.co.uk$ [NC] RewriteRule ^(.*)$ http://www.
fly-fishing-tackle.co.uk/$1 [L,R=301]
